How long does it typically take to complete the Ofqual Level 2 Certificate in Computerised Accounting course?

Completing the Ofqual Level 2 Certificate in Computerised Accounting course typically takes around 6 months to 1 year, depending on the pace at which you study and the amount of time you can dedicate to the course each week. This course is designed to provide you with a solid foundation in computerised accounting principles and practices, preparing you for entry-level roles in the accounting field.

Throughout the course, you will learn how to use accounting software, process financial transactions, prepare financial statements, and more. The curriculum is comprehensive and covers all the essential skills and knowledge needed to excel in the field of computerised accounting.
